Avishalom Westreich is an Associate Professor (Senior Lecturer) of Jewish Law, Family Law, and Jurisprudence, at the College of Law and Business in Ramat Gan and a Research Fellow at the Kogod Research Center for Contemporary Jewish Thought at Shalom Hartman Institute, Jerusalem. He was a Visiting Scholar at the Petrie-Flom Center for Health Law Policy, Biotechnology, and Bioethics, at Harvard Law School (Fall 2017), a Helen Gartner Hammer Scholar-in-Residence at the Hadassah-Brandeis Institute, Brandeis University (Fall 2016), and a research fellow at the Agunah Research Unit at the University of Manchester (2007-2008).
His research deals primarily with the dramatic changes in the family during the second half of the twentieth and the beginning of the twenty-first centuries. His previous publications include No-Fault Divorce in the Jewish Tradition (2014 [Hebrew]) and Talmud-Based Solutions to the Problem of the Agunah (Agunah Research Unit, vol. 4, 2012).
